发明名称 DEVICE AND METHOD FOR MAKING A THREE-DIMENSIONAL OBJECT
摘要 A device for the making of a three-dimensional object (3) by means of layer by layer consolidation of a powderlike construction material (11) by electromagnetic radiation or particle beam has a height-adjustable carrier (2), on which the object (3) is built, and whose horizontal dimension defines a construction field (5). Furthermore, an irradiation device (6, 9) is present for directing the radiation onto regions of an applied layer of the construction material within the construction field (5) corresponding to an object cross section (30). A control unit (10) controls the irradiation device (6, 9) such that the powder particles of the construction material (11) are bonded together at the sites where the radiation impinges on the construction material. A selective heating device (18a, 18b) is designed so that any given partial surface (19) of the construction field (5) can be heated before and/or after to a plateau temperature, which is significantly higher than the temperature of at least a portion of the construction field (5) outside the partial surface (19). The control unit (10) actuates the selective heating device (18a, 18b) such that the partial surface (19) has a predefined minimum distance (d) from the edge of the construction field (5).

Device for the making of a three-dimensional object by means of layer by layer consolidation of a powderlike construction material by electromagnetic radiation or particle radiation with: a height-adjustable carrier, on which the object is built, and whose horizontal dimension defines a construction field, an irradiation device for directing the electromagnetic radiation or particle radiation onto regions of an applied layer of the construction material within the construction field corresponding to an object cross section, a control unit for controlling the irradiation device such that the powder particles of the construction material are bonded together at the sites where the electromagnetic radiation or particle radiation impinges on the construction material, characterized by a selective heating device, which is designed so that any given partial surface of the construction field can be heated to a plateau temperature, which plateau temperature is significantly higher than the temperature of at least a portion of the construction field outside the partial surface, wherein the control unit is designed so that it actuates the selective heating device such that the partial surface has a predefined minimum distance from the edge of the construction field.
